Transaction 3e8ca81109b312c1095063f8db6a5171bde78a8bfd1b0bc66d759d04cec56ea9

1 Input
2 Outputs
  • 3e8ca81109b312c1095063f8db6a5171bde78a8bfd1b0bc66d759d04cec56ea9:0
  • value  4759694
    address  12ViREEApUfsWDqJ539jFGbkVmiYQsDMe5
  • 3e8ca81109b312c1095063f8db6a5171bde78a8bfd1b0bc66d759d04cec56ea9:1
  • value  91088788
    address  17CwX8nxDv3K5MgZjgjW8fiAsYFqZFsrqJ